Be Connected: Vulnerability Scans with CISA

Fri. January 1, 2027 | 1:00 pm - 1:45 pm CST

This week on Be Connected – we’ll discuss how proactive vulnerability scanning can identify “low-hanging fruit” for attackers before they are exploited, with a special guest.

Tune in to hear from Tony Collings, Cybersecurity State Coordinator with CISA, who will share details on their no-cost Cyber Hygiene Services, which was designed specifically for K-12 districts and helps them monitor their internet-facing assets.

Join the conversation to learn how to enroll in these recurring weekly scans, how to interpret the risk-prioritized reports, and how to use CISA’s expert guidance to strengthen your district’s defense without straining your budget.

Be Connected is a virtual networking series designed to spark meaningful conversations and collaboration within Illinois’ K–12 technology community.

Hosted by the LTC’s Technology Services team, each free session centers around a different relevant topic, ranging from infrastructure planning and cybersecurity to emerging tools, networking strategies, and day-to-day IT challenges. These informal yet purposeful sessions offer a relaxed and supportive environment where participants can ask questions, share experiences, and learn from one another.
